#2 SEO Integration
You don’t need a comprehensive SEO package with your eCommerce web quotation, I understand. But do ensure that your web developer has mentioned integrating SEO plugins or modules with your eCommerce store.
Also insist your web developer build your website with SEO norms (SEO-friendly URLs, complete category/product names in the URL, search engine optimized image tags, header tags, meta tags, and most importantly fast loading speed for all the pages).
Having on-page (webpages) SEO done is half battle won.

#5 CMS Used
It must be written in your website proposal about the CMS that your web developer will be using to build your eCommerce website.
For eg., whether he will use WordPress, Drupal, Shopify, Prestashop, or Magento, he must specify clearly in the quotation.

#6 Instruction Manual
Once the website development is completed, your web developer must provide you with a manual to follow and manage your eCommerce store. Without a properly documented manual, you may face issues to manage the website when your web developer is no more working with you.
#7 Short Training
Most web design companies or web developers would provide you with short training along with the instruction manual (as stated above) so that you have a thorough understanding of website management.
You must ask your web developer to include a short training that he must provide you after the website completion so that you can manage your store in a better way. There shouldn’t be any additional charges for this short training.
#8 Support & Warranty
For how long your web developer will help you to fix the bugs and issues on the website if you report them after the website launch? Yes, there could be chances where you may report some bugs which you may not have noticed pre-launch.
In many cases, my clients complain about their previous web developers and that they do not entertain their customers anymore after the website launch. Rather they demand money to fix the bugs.
So to be on the safer side, before you hire any web developer to develop your eCommerce website, you must ensure that there is a clause in the quotation that talks about the support and warranty to fix any issues, that may arise.
